Thurstin Surname Meaning
From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history
TURSTAN: From the Old English personal name Thurstan, ON. Thorsteinn, 'Thur's stone,' Normanized Turstan, Turstan de Crectune (Crichton) who witnessed David's great charter to Holyrood, c. 1128 (LSC., p. 6) may be Turstan filius Levingi, a. 1158 (ibid., p. 7). Radulf filius Turstain was witness to David's great charter to Melrose, a. 1153 (Nat, MSS., I, 17). Malcolm filius Malcolmi Thurstan, c. 1330, is again referred to at same date as Malcolmus filius Malcolmi filii Thurstan (RHM., I, p. 39, 40).

How Common Is The Last Name Thurstin?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 1,398,030th most commonly occurring surname on earth. It is borne by approximately 1 in 46,715,038 people. The last name occurs predominantly in The Americas, where 97 percent of Thurstin are found; 97 percent are found in North America and 97 percent are found in Anglo-North America.
The last name Thurstin is most widely held in The United States, where it is carried by 152 people, or 1 in 2,384,598. In The United States Thurstin is primarily found in: Minnesota, where 32 percent are found, Pennsylvania, where 18 percent are found and Colorado, where 14 percent are found. Apart from The United States this last name is found in one country. It is also found in England, where 3 percent are found.
Thurstin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The prevalency of Thurstin has changed through the years. In The United States the share of the population with the surname decreased 18 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it decreased 67 percent between 1881 and 2014.
